What is Square Payments?
Square Payments is a mobile and in-person payment processing solution used by small business owners — independent retailers, food vendors, and service providers — to accept card payments via smartphone or tablet without dedicated point-of-sale hardware. It combines a free card reader, simple per-transaction pricing, and basic sales reporting in one app, making it easy for low-volume merchants to start accepting cards. Larger merchants typically outgrow its reporting depth and multi-location management capabilities.

Square Payments Pricing Plans
IN-PERSON PAYMENTS
Next-business-day transfers
Free Square Reader for magstripe
Free Square Point of Sale app
Live phone support
Fast online sign-up
Show more +
CARD-NOT-PRESENT PAYMENTS
Square Invoices card transactions: 2.9% + 30¢
Square Virtual Terminal transactions: 3.5% + 15¢
Card-not-present transactions: 3.5% + 15¢
Card on File transactions: 3.5% + 15¢
eCommerce transactions: 2.9% + 30¢
Show more +
CUSTOM BUILDS
Terminal API and Reader SDK transactions: 2.6% + 10¢
In-App Payments SDK transactions: 2.9% + 30¢
Online Payment APIs transactions: 2.9% + 30¢
